A mistake I've seen described more than once here and in the BP forums is someone creating an extension entity, then creating the relationship as 1:M or M:1 because 1:1 isn't available, when what they should have done is check "Is Extension" and set the parent table on the Entity's Entity tab.

The advice I've read is to delete everything (the relationship, the quickform and the entity?) and start over, this time setting the entity as an extension.

Well, I was't looking forward to recreating my whole quickform, so I went ahead and checked "Is Extension," set the table to Account, deleted the 1:M relationship, rebuilt & redeployed. Of course then the form did not display any data.

The next thing I tried was to open the form, and reset the data bindings. On each control I removed the mapping, reset the mapping, then saved it. Now the data is back on display.

Just thought I'd share, in case anyone is bothered by a 1:M relationship they have that should be an extension.

I have this problem, also, where no data shows up. I have a tab form that has several bound columns, one of which is supposed to disply a caolumn from the extension table. IN the column editor, the properties for that tabel do not appear. INstead the table name appears just as it did when I ahd a relationship in place. So I picked the table name, and added the .Status to the end to supposedly get the information from the Status column in the extension table.

Again, no data displays. So when you talk about resetting the mappings, please explain what you mean. Are you talking about resetting hte datafields on all the columns on the form or something else?
